Airport Express, the strategic trade rail alliance for Gatwick,
Heathrow and Stansted Express trains, is to launch an onboard magazine,
published by Mediamark. More than 200,000 copies of the bi-monthly Big
City will be distributed.

The British Tourist Association is planning a 5m
international marketing campaign to run from January through March, and
will hire advertising and media agencies through the COI roster. The
campaign will focus on the UK's heritage, countryside, cities and sport.
